Transaction 34e87613a32df0535614002052d49dc3714966f33a706a6f138f4c03425bfccb

1 Input
2 Outputs
  • 34e87613a32df0535614002052d49dc3714966f33a706a6f138f4c03425bfccb:0
  • value  1256587
    address  1GAo8EnbuWVeB252XVjei8MzCq2JVUtR2s
  • 34e87613a32df0535614002052d49dc3714966f33a706a6f138f4c03425bfccb:1
  • value  3769763
    address  3BeuRYrRg2CA8fq7jiqth9EU6XWmhyxqKx